.content{
    top:56px
}

.sidebar{
    margin-top: 30px;
}


.sidebar ul li .active{
    color: rgb(7, 193, 96) !important;
    font-weight: 700 !important;
    /* text-decoration: underline !important; */
  
}

.title{
    font-size: 20px;
    font-weight: 700;
    
    /* margin-left: 25px; */
}

.menuContent{
    margin-top: 10px;
}

.subContent{
    margin-top: 10px;
}

/* 调整侧边栏<li>标签的间距 */
.sidebar-nav li {
    margin: 0px 0; /* 调整底部间距，根据需要修改这个值 */
    padding: 5px 0; /* 调整内部上下填充，根据需要修改这个值 */
    font-size: 14px;
}

.sidebar-nav li {
    padding: 3px 0;
}

/* 一级父节点目录 */
.sidebar li  p, .sidebar li a ,.sidebar ul li a {
    cursor: pointer;
    font-size: 17px;
    font-weight: 600;
    /* ::before{
        content: "1"; 
    }; */
}

/* 二级父节点 */
.sidebar li ul li p, .sidebar li ul li a{
    font-size: 14px;
    font-weight: 600;
    color: black;
    margin-left: 3px;

    /* ::before{
        content: "2"; 
    }; */
}

/* 三级父节点 */
.sidebar li ul li ul li p,.sidebar li ul li ul li a{
    font-size: 14px;
    color: black;
    margin-left: 3px;
    /* margin-top: -2px; */
    font-weight: 500;
    /* ::before{
        content: "3"; 
    }; */
}

/* 四级父节点 */
.sidebar li ul li ul li ul li p,.sidebar li ul li ul li ul li a{
    font-size: 13px;
    color: black;
    margin-left: 3px;
    margin-top: -5px;
    font-weight: 500;
}

/* 五级父节点 */
.sidebar li ul li ul li ul li ul li p,.sidebar li ul li ul li ul li ul li a{
    font-size: 13px;
    color: black;
    margin-left: 3px;
    margin-top: -5px;
    font-weight: 500;
}





/* 导航栏 */

.navigate{
    position: fixed;top: 0;
    width: 100%; height: 56px;
    background-color: white;
    border-bottom: 1px solid #eee;
    z-index: 10000;
}

#logo{
    position:absolute;left:36px;top: 15px;
    display: flex;align-items: center; /* 垂直居中 */
}
#logoPic{
    height: 26px;margin-right: 10px;
}


#backToTop {
    width: 50px;height: auto;
    position: fixed;bottom: 40px;right: 20px;
    display: none; /* 默认不显示，滚动时显示 */
    align-items: center;
    cursor: pointer;
    padding: 12px ;
    background-color: white;
    color: white;
    border: none;box-shadow: 0 0 10px #eee;
    border-radius: 50%;
  }




  /* 搜索 */

.search{
    position:absolute;right:30px;width:25%;height: 44px;
    /* padding: 6px; */
    /* border: 1px solid #eee; */
    z-index: 10;background-color: transparent;

}

.results-panel {
    display: none; 
    background-color: white; z-index: 10000;
    /* height:400px; */
    overflow-y: auto;overflow-x:hidden;
}

.results-panel.show{
    padding: 10px;border: 1px solid #eee;border-radius: 3px;
}

.search .input-wrap{
    border: 1px solid #eee;border-radius: 5px;
    background-color: white;
}





/* 图片预览 */
.imgModal
{
    position: fixed;left:0;top:0;
    width: 100%;height:100%;
    display: none;

    padding-top: 60px;
}

.imgModal .bg
{
    position: absolute;left:0;top:0;
    width: 100%;height:100%;
    background: rgba(0,0,0,0.6);
}

.imgModal .con
{
    width: 1400px;
    margin:0 auto;
    /* position: relative; */
    z-index: 100;

}

.imgModal .con img
{
    display: block;
    width: 100% !important;
    /* margin-top: 150px; */
}



button{
    border:none;
    background-color: transparent;
    margin:-5px;
    cursor: pointer;
    color:rgb(7, 193, 96) ;
    font-size: 15px;font-weight: 600;text-decoration: underline;
}